The Psychology of Security: How Visual Deterrents Protect Your Property

When protecting property, perception can be as powerful as physical barriers. Visible security measures, such as CCTV cameras, intruder alarms and warning signage, send a clear message to potential intruders that your property isn’t an easy target.

Just the presence of these measures can create a perception of heightened risk, making criminals think twice before attempting a break-in. They know that the chances of getting caught are significantly higher when security measures are in place and visible.

This psychological deterrent is one of the most effective strategies in crime prevention. Studies have shown that burglars are far less likely to target homes or businesses where security systems are prominently displayed.

How do deterrents work?

Criminals typically seek out properties that offer the least resistance. Places where they can get in and out quickly without drawing attention. Visible security measures disrupt this sense of ease, forcing them to reconsider their plans.

The psychology behind this deterrence is simple: the more obstacles a criminal perceives, the more likely they are to move on to a less protected target.

How best to use security measures as deterrents?

There are various ways in which the likes of CCTV, alarm systems and security signage can be used as deterrents:

CCTV Cameras Positioned Prominently

CCTV cameras not only act as a visual warning but also instil a fear of being recorded, identified, and subsequently caught.

Placing cameras in visible locations, such as above entrances or overlooking key areas of the property, ensures they are easily noticed by anyone approaching. The sight of a camera, especially one that’s modern and well-maintained, can be enough to deter criminal activity.

Alarm System Boxes with Clear Branding

Alarm systems remind criminals that any unauthorised access will trigger immediate attention, whether it’s from the property owner, a security company, or the police.

Intruder alarm boxes mounted on the exterior of the property serve as a bold statement that security measures are active. Clear branding adds an extra layer of deterrence, signalling that the system is professionally monitored and maintained.

Security Signage

Simple yet effective, signage explaining that the property is protected by a security system can be a strong deterrent. Placed near entry points or along the perimeter, signs make it clear that the property is under professional protection, further discouraging unauthorised access.

The Art of Security: Designing Systems that Complement Your Property’s Aesthetics

While security is paramount, it’s equally important that your protective measures don’t compromise the aesthetic appeal of your property.

Whether it’s a historic building with intricate architectural details, or a modern home with a sleek design, finding the right balance between security and visual appeal is crucial. Integrating security systems in a way that preserves, or even enhances, the property’s appearance is a challenge that requires both expertise and a keen eye for design.

Security shouldn’t come at the cost of your property’s character. A well-designed security system not only provides protection, but also blends seamlessly into the environment, ensuring that your property remains both secure and visually pleasing.

Modern Security Systems and Aesthetics

Advances in technology have allowed for more discreet and aesthetically pleasing security solutions.

For example, modern CCTV cameras are now available in compact, low-profile designs that can be mounted in less conspicuous locations without sacrificing functionality.

Similarly, alarm systems can be designed to blend into the architecture, with control panels and sensors that are both functional and visually unobtrusive.

Even traditional elements like security lighting can be integrated in a way that complements the property’s exterior, ensuring that every aspect of the security system aligns with the overall design.

Tailoring Security to the Property

In some situations, it is important to customise the security system to match the unique style and character of each property. For example:

Historic properties: In heritage properties where preservation is the key, it’s important to ensure security systems are installed without affecting the building’s original features. This might involve discreetly placing cameras or choosing alarm boxes that match the building’s exterior colour and style, ensuring they blend in seamlessly.

Modern homes: For contemporary properties, sleek, minimalistic designs are the order of the day. From low-profile cameras to wireless alarm systems that eliminate unsightly wiring, every element should be chosen with aesthetics in mind.

Luxury properties: In homes with high value assets, security is integrated as part of the overall design vision. This might include hidden cameras, custom finishes on security hardware, or even integrating security systems into smart home technology, ensuring that protection is as elegant as it is effective.

By combining cutting-edge technology with a thoughtful approach to design, it is possible to ensure that your property remains both secure and visually appealing.
